conflict between IE7 and BT Broadband desktop help

When I downloaded the recommended update to IE7 I recieved the following
error alert for BT Broadband Help Notifier:-

SMART BRIDGE ALERT
GET PROCESSIMAGEFILENAMEW COULD NOT BE LOCATED IN THE DYNAMIC LINK LIBRARY
PSAPI.DLL

BT Broadband desk top help stopped working after that. I only managed to
solve the problem by restoring my computer to a point prior to the IE7 update
being installed.

Can anyone help?

Re: conflict between IE7 and BT Broadband desktop help

Motive SmartBridge© is distributing an old version of PSAPI.DLL. As a
result, users might receive the following error message after installation
of Internet Explorer 7:

"SmartBridge Alerts:MotiveSB.exe Entry Point Not Found The procedure entry
point GetProcessImageFileNameW could not be located in the dynamic link
library PSAPI.DLL"

To work around this error:

* Go to the installation location for SmartBridge (\Program
Files\Verizon...\Smart...)

* Find PSAPI.DLL and rename it to something like PSAPIOLD.DLL

* NB: Do NOT rename the PSAPI.DLL file in C:\Windows\System32 directory!

* Restart the computer.

Source: IE7 Beta Release Notes.

Re: conflict between IE7 and BT Broadband desktop help

Just renaming PSAPI.DLL does not cure the problem with BT Broadband
Help - you still get script errors.

BT claim they're working on this but at the moment their only solution
is to revert to IE6.

John

RE: conflict between IE7 and BT Broadband desktop help

Hi, I had same problem. Traced offending psapi.dll to broadband medic
(program files\ntl\broadband and uninstalled broadband medic program.
(renaming file caused internet connection to fail) may need to re-enable the
USB cable modem through device manager after uninstalling medic
